StageGFRDescriptionAction
G1≥ 90Normal/HighStandard dosing; monitor
G260–89Mildly decreasedMinimal dose adjustment
G3a45–59Mild-moderate decreaseDose adjustments needed
G3b30–44Moderate-severe decreaseAvoid nephrotoxins
G415–29Severely decreasedPrepare for RRT
G5< 15Kidney failureDialysis/transplant
MDRD 4-variable:
GFR = 175 × (SCr)^(−1.154) × (Age)^(−0.203) × 0.742 [if female] × 1.212 [if African American]
Limitation: MDRD significantly underestimates GFR when true GFR >60 mL/min/1.73m². CKD-EPI 2021 is preferred for all patients. MDRD reports GFR as ">60" when calculated above that threshold. Race-based multiplier (African American) is included for historical reference but race-free CKD-EPI 2021 is now recommended.
